      Meaning of the first name Vasyl

      Origin

      Language/place of Origin: Ukrainian, Russian

      Meaning

      Meaning, Royal or Kingly

      Variations

      Vasya, Vasile, Vasili
      The name Vasyl is of Slavic origin, primarily associated with Ukrainian and Russian cultures. It derives from the Greek name Basileios, meaning king or royal. Thus, Vasyl embodies attributes of leadership and nobility, which is reflective of its etymological roots. The name conveys a sense of strength and dignity, making it a significant choice for parents seeking a name with powerful connotations.

      Vasyl has a long and storied history, particularly in Ukraine, where it has been a common name for centuries. The name's prominence can be traced back to various historical figures, including saints and leaders. For instance, Saint Basil the Great, a major Christian theologian, heavily influenced the popularity of the name in Eastern Orthodox cultures. Over time, Vasyl became a familiar name among the populace and has been used by numerous notable figures in literature, art, and politics.

      In contemporary society, Vasyl remains a prevalent name, especially in Ukraine, where it is often associated with traditional values and heritage. While its popularity may fluctuate, it continues to hold cultural significance. Many individuals bearing the name Vasyl contribute to various fields such as academia, sports, and the arts, keeping the name in active circulation. Additionally, as Ukrainian and Russian communities have spread globally, the name has gained recognition beyond its original borders, enriching the cultural tapestry of other nations.
